Story summary
  • Oracle announced a new round of layoffs on September 14, 2026.
  • Severance includes four weeks of base salary plus one week per year of tenure.
  • The workforce fell by roughly 21,000 employees, a 13% decline, in fiscal 2026.
  • Oracle spent $28.5 billion on capital expenditures this quarter, up from $8.5 billion a year earlier.
  • CFO Hilary Maxson urged selective spending, rejecting ‘doing more with less’ as AI investment surged.
